Tron: Ares Posts Major Box Office Losses
Tron: Ares, directed by Joachim Rønning and starring Jared Leto, has opened to mixed-to-negative reviews (about 52–53% on Rotten Tomatoes) and weak box-office returns. The film plunged roughly 65–66% in its second domestic weekend to about $11.1 million, leaving a two-week worldwide total near $103 million. Budget estimates vary — reports cite a $180 million net production cost while Deadline lists production at $220 million — and marketing is estimated at roughly $100–102 million, putting total spend near $347.5 million by Deadline’s accounting. Using those totals, industry projections show the picture could lose about $130–133 million even after ancillary revenue, putting sequel prospects in doubt and adding to Jared Leto’s recent string of underperformers. With a long theatrical-to-PVOD window at Disney, analysts say the film’s best path to mitigate losses is post-theatrical streaming and ancillary markets, but recovery looks challenging.
